"Which of them are you gonna date?"
Kairi blinked and looked up at Selphie. "What?"
"Riku and Sora, of course! You know, the boys you've been staring at all day," Selphie said, elbowing her. "Geez, you can be so slow sometimes, Kairi. I was asking which of them you're planning to date!"
For a moment, Kairi looked slightly confused. Then she smiled. "Oh, I don't know, which would you choose?"
Selphie made a face, pausing for thought. "Weeeeell, I don't know if I could. Sora's cute, but Riku's got that... what would you call it? Mystery. He'd be very interesting, I think."
"What about you?" Kairi asked, nudging Selphie gently. "Tidus or Wakka?"
"Mm, that's not fair, I really can't choose!" She grinned. "They're each as hopeless as the other."
"Maybe it's better not to choose," Kairi said, softly. She stood up, brushing sand from her skirt. "Having favourites isn't fair, after all."
Selphie blinked. Kairi smiled at her, then turned and ran down to the beach where Riku and Sora were sparring.
